The region experienced relatively calm conditions today after a period of Iranian escalation, with Thursday passing without any missile or drone attacks. This comes in the context of expectations that an agreement between Washington and Tehran will be reached regarding Iran’s nuclear issue and regional security. The deal is likely to include fourteen clauses, emphasizing guarantees that Iran will not acquire nuclear weapons and aims to improve security in the Strait of Hormuz to enhance trade and investment flows. The success of this détente is linked to Iran’s political stance and behavior, with the Gulf community focusing on the need for genuine and lasting change in Iran’s actions, rather than merely signing temporary agreements.
